A Guide to Backpacking Essentials in the US

Embarking on a trekking expedition through the diverse terrain of the USA is an incredible opportunity. Whether you're a beginner backpacker, mastering the basics of backpacking will guarantee a safe and enjoyable experience.

First, here consider your gear. A well-fitted backpack is crucial, along with suitable garments for varying climate changes. A reliable compass will help you navigate the paths, and a first-aid kit should be a must-have for any unforeseen events.

Beyond gear, hone your skills before hitting the route. Learn how to set up camp, purify water for safety, and pack efficiently to minimize weight.

  • Respect wildlife
  • Minimize your impact
  • Inform someone of your plans

By equipping yourself well, you can enjoy a safe and fulfilling backpacking experience in the USA.

Embark on a Journey: US Backpacking Made Simple

Ready to escape into the wilderness? Backpacking through the US offers breathtaking experiences, from snow-capped mountain ranges to ancient forests. Whether you're a seasoned hiker or just starting out, this simple guide will equip you with the essentials for an enjoyable and safe trip. First, choose your destination – the US boasts a extensive array of trails, each with its own unique appeal. Next, pack your gear: a sturdy backpack, supportive hiking boots, a dependable sleeping bag, and crucial clothing for all climates.

  • Keep in mind to study the trail you'll be hiking – knowledge with the terrain, weather conditions, and potential hazards is essential.
  • Always let someone of your itinerary and expected return time.
  • Minimize your impact on the environment by practicing Leave No Trace principles.

Savor the journey! Backpacking is an opportunity to connect with nature, test yourself physically and mentally, and create lasting memories.
